Position Summary:
Where we commit to hire the best and support our people to be their best.
Founded in 2004, Cameron Stephens is a leading Canadian real estate investment firm with just under $3.6 billion in assets under administration (AUA). Cameron Stephens offers institutional and private investors strategic opportunities to invest in commercial real estate with consistent returns. The firm specializes in mortgage solutions through Cameron Stephens Mortgage Capital (CSMC) for developers across Canada. Established in 2021, Cameron Stephens Equity Capital (CSEC) provides equity opportunities for high-quality and strategically positioned developments.
Leveraging deep market expertise and strong industry partnerships, Cameron Stephens is recognized as a key player in Canada’s real estate investment landscape, delivering sustainable growth and financial success.
We manage capital on behalf of various partners, including banks, insurance companies, pension funds, family offices, credit unions, and individual investors.
We are seeking a Senior Associate – Special Loans who will be responsible for supporting the management, resolution, and reporting of underperforming, impaired, high-risk, or complex loans across the portfolio. The role sits within the Special Loans group and works directly with the VP, Special Loans to execute workout strategies, monitor borrower performance, coordinate stakeholder communication, and manage investor reporting obligations.
The role is execution-heavy and requires strong financial analysis, organizational discipline, communication skills, and attention to detail. The Associate acts as the operational and analytical backbone of the Special Loans function, ensuring that strategies developed by the VP are implemented accurately and efficiently.
This role is not a passive monitoring function. The Associate is expected to actively manage files, drive follow-ups, coordinate with internal and external stakeholders, and maintain tight control over timelines, reporting, documentation, and action items.
Key Responsibilities
Portfolio Monitoring & File Management
Monitor a portfolio of watchlist, distressed, defaulted, and high-risk loans.
Maintain detailed file-level tracking for arrears, maturity status, covenant breaches, legal proceedings, borrower reporting obligations, recovery actions, property performance and enforcement milestones
Maintain accurate and current internal reporting trackers and dashboards.
Ensure all file notes, borrower communications, investor updates, and action items are documented and organized.
Coordinate and track conditions, deadlines, and deliverables across active files.
Identify emerging risks and escalate material issues promptly.
Execution of Workout & Recovery Strategies
Execute strategies developed by the VP, Special Loans.
Coordinate implementation of extensions, restructurings, forbearance arrangements, paydown strategies, enforcement actions, sales processes, refinancing strategies, and receivership and legal processes
Prepare file summaries, strategy memorandums, extension requests, and recovery analysis.
Coordinate with legal counsel, receivers, brokers, consultants, appraisers, and other third-party professionals.
Monitor borrower compliance with negotiated agreements and reporting requirements.
Track legal and enforcement costs, timelines, and recovery expectations.
Investor Management & Reporting
Serve as a day-to-day contact for investors on Special Loans files.
Coordinate investor communications, updates, approvals, and information requests.
Prepare investor reporting materials, including status updates, recovery summaries, cash flow reporting, strategy recommendations, extension requests and impairment commentary
Ensure investor communications are timely, accurate, and professionally presented.
Coordinate investor consent processes and maintain records of approvals and responses.
Support the VP, Special Loans in maintaining strong investor relationships during complex or stressed situations.
Financial & Credit Analysis
Analyze borrower financial statements, rent rolls, appraisals, quantity surveyor reports, legal documentation, construction budgets, cash flow performance and recovery scenarios,
Build and maintain financial models related to recovery analysis, payoff strategies, refinancing scenarios, liquidation outcomes, interest reserve analysis and sensitivity analysis
Assess collateral performance and debt recovery prospects.
Assist in impairment and provisioning analysis where required.
Internal Coordination
Work closely with Origination, Syndication, Funding & Servicing, Accounting and Executive Management
Coordinate internal approvals and ensure information flow across departments.
Assist in preparation of management reporting and portfolio review materials.
Support process improvement initiatives, reporting automation, and workflow standardization within the Special Loans group.

What we believe our ideal candidate will possess:
Qualifications & Experience
Undergraduate degree in, Finance, Commerce, Real Estate, Economics, Accounting or related field
CPA designation would be a plus!
2–5 years of experience in commercial real estate lending, restructuring, special loans, underwriting, asset management, commercial banking or workout environments
Strong understanding of commercial real estate lending structures and security.
Familiarity with enforcement processes, receiverships, insolvency, proceedings, restructuring strategies, construction lending, and income-producing assets is considered an asset.
Technical Skills and Interpersonal Characteristics
Strong financial modeling and Excel capabilities.
Ability to analyze complex credit situations and real estate assets.
Strong written communication and reporting skills.
High attention to detail and organizational discipline.
Ability to manage multiple complex files simultaneously.
Comfortable operating in high-pressure and time-sensitive situations.
Strong judgment and ability to escalate issues appropriately.
Highly accountable and execution-oriented.
Calm under pressure.
Intellectually rigorous and detail-focused.
Strong follow-through and responsiveness.
Able to manage difficult conversations professionally.
Comfortable working in ambiguous or evolving situations.
Operates with urgency while maintaining accuracy.
